HomePublic Services & GovernmentUnited StatesCaliforniaSan Carlos
Public Services & Government
610 Elm St, Ste 212, San Carlos, CA 94070, US
Public Services & Government, Landmarks & Historical Buildings
666 Elm St, San Carlos, CA 94070, US